U.S. President Donald Trump shared that he and Melania Trump will be attending the Pope’s funeral.

“Melania and I will be going to the funeral of Pope Francis, in Rome. We look forward to being there!” he wrote on Truth Social.

The Pope’s funeral is planned for Saturday at 10 a.m. local time (4 a.m. eastern) at St. Peter’s Basilica.

Other leaders will attend, including Ukrainian President Volodymyr Zelenskyy, France’s Emmanuel Macron, Italian Prime Minister Giorgia Meloni, U.K. Prime Minister Keir Starmer and Germany’s outgoing Chancellor Olaf Scholz, among others, according to CBS News.

As the outlet reported: “After the funeral Mass at St. Peter’s, Pope Francis’ coffin will be taken to the Basilica of St. Mary Major in Rome, where he will be entombed. The pope chose to be buried at the smaller basilica, which is about four miles away, outside the Vatican walls. He prayed at St. Mary’s often, before and after international trips during his 12-year pontificate.”

The cause of Pope Francis’ death was released after the Pope died on Easter Monday at the age of 88.

Per the Vatican, the Pope died due to a stroke, followed by a coma and irreversible cardiocirculatory collapse, as the Vatican News reported.

Per the medical report, the cause of death was confirmed through electrocardiographic thanatography.

As The Vatican News reported, the Pope “had a prior history of acute respiratory failure caused by multimicrobial bilateral pneumonia, multiple bronchiectases, high blood pressure, and Type II diabetes.”
